Angela's Story
I started working at the Chicago Public Library in the summer before my senior year (1966). I am still working as a Librarian. I am still best friends with Margaret (Rastutis) Fashing. She recently retired from the Chicago Board of Education. She was a school librarian. Funny how both of us became librarians.
I have been married for 30 years to Joseph, an attorney in private practice with offices in downtown Chicago.
We live on the near west side of Chicago, near the UIC (formerly Circle) Campus. We are both alums.

I play guitar. appalachian mountain dulcimer, and have taken a class in mandolin. I love folk music and Irish music. I have a special interest in Irish set dancing and ceili dancing. My husband and I also do cajun and zydeco dancing.
We attend many live music concerts, and are supporters of the Old Town School of Folk Music.
We travel every year to New Orleans for music festivals. we have also traveled extensively in Europe: London, Paris, Amsterdam, Spain, Belgium, Portugal, Italy, Vienna, Budapest, and Prague.
